View full screenMask used in the Sinhalese mask play, kolam, representing a man's face with a cap, the yellow colour representing a high-ranking figure or a merchant, carved Kaduru wood (Strychnos nux vomica) painted yellow, red and black: Sri Lanka, early - mid 19th century
